About this swimming hole
A small, clear alpine lake in the RMNP backcountry with a rocky shoreline made for a quick plunge. Island Lake rewards hikers on the Flattop Mountain trail with solitude and cold, clean water. The swim is short; the bragging rights are long.
Good to know
| Water type | Lake |
|---|---|
| Water temperature | very cold |
| Depth | alpine lake; swim near shore |
| Best season | July-September |
| Fees | RMNP entry fee |
| Reservations required | No |
| Hours | sunrise-sunset |
| Parking | Trailhead lot |
| County | Larimer County |
| Nearest town | Estes Park |
| Safety notes | No lifeguard; very cold; altitude |
